Output fc89aacf6e6f18f105f97d43db009574e62f3a1f3c35ec49ebe29bf75cdcbb5a:0

value
42760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a7232041448eb56abbae6d2646aba8eefe0fe0 OP_EQUAL
address
38xBXbV3T2tYac3KHQHUVFpUUvMfW5ne5x
transaction
fc89aacf6e6f18f105f97d43db009574e62f3a1f3c35ec49ebe29bf75cdcbb5a
confirmations
3702
spent
true